How to Check Driving Licence Application Status in Nagaland Online

You can check your driving licence application in Nagaland without visiting the RTO. The Parivahan portal is the official platform to check your licence status in Nagaland. You only need your application number and date of birth.

Go to the official Parivahan website.

Select "Online Services" then choose "Driving Licence Related Services".

You will be redirected to the Sarathi portal.

Select Nagaland as your state and enter your application number and date of birth.

Fill in the captcha and click on Submit.

You will see the current status, such as pending approval or dispatched.

How to Check Driving Licence Application Status in Nagaland Offline?

If you cannot access the internet, you can check your driving licence status in person. Visit the nearest RTO office in Nagaland.

Go to the driving licence enquiry counter.

Give your application number or date of birth.

The RTO officer will check your status and update you.

This method is useful if you prefer direct help or face issues with online tracking.

Eligibility by Licence Type in Nagaland

Below is a clear overview of the eligibility requirements for each type of driving licence in Nagaland, based on vehicle category and applicant criteria.

Licence Type Eligibility Criteria
Learner's Licence
  • 16 years for gearless two-wheelers up to 50 cc.
  • 18 years for motorcycles and cars.
  • Must know traffic rules.
Permanent Licence
  • Must be 18 years old.
  • Hold a learner's licence for at least 30 days.
  • Pass the driving test.
Commercial Licence
  • Must be 20 years old.
  • One year of experience with a light motor vehicle.
  • Medical fitness is required.
International Driving Permit
  • Must be 18 years old.
  • Must hold a valid permanent driving licence.
  • Submit passport and visa copies.

Documents Required for Driving Licence in Nagaland

Age Proof: Submit a birth certificate, school certificate, passport, or voter ID to confirm your age.

Address Proof: Provide a ration card, utility bill, electoral roll, or passport to verify your address.

Medical Certificate: Use Form 1 for non-commercial licences or Form 1A if applying for a commercial licence or if over 50.

Photographs: Attach recent passport-size photographs with your application.

Driving Licence Fees in Nagaland

The table below lists the official fees for different types of driving licences in Nagaland. Charges may vary by vehicle class and type of service.

Licence Type Cost (₹)
Learner's Licence 200
Permanent Licence 250
Commercial Licence 500
International Driving Permit 1000
Renewal of DL 200
Duplicate DL 200

Why Driving Licence Status May Be Delayed in Nagaland

Several factors may cause delays in updating the latest state of your DL application in Nagaland:

Document Errors: Blurry or mismatched voter ID, ration card, or photograph may lead to slow verification.

Remote RTO Operations: Limited staffing at smaller RTOs such as Dimapur or Kohima can lead to backlogs.

Challenging Terrain: Mountainous and hilly roads in rural areas may delay document transport.

System Glitches: Temporary issues in the Parivahan portal may disrupt tracking.

Failed Driving Tests: If you do not pass your test, you must wait for the next available slot for retesting.

Important Tips Before You Check Your Driving Licence Status in Nagaland

To avoid errors or failed attempts, keep these points in mind before checking your DL application status online in Nagaland:

Double-check your application number.

Enter your date of birth exactly as mentioned in your application form.

Use only official portals like Parivahan.

If your licence has been dispatched, track it using the Speed Post number on the India Post website.

Pay off pending e-challans. In some cases, unpaid fines can delay licence delivery.

Quick Facts About Driving Licences in India

Here are some essential points every licence holder or applicant in India should know:

Driving licences are issued under the Motor Vehicle Act of 1988.

A standard driving licence remains valid for 20 years or until the holder turns 40.

Main licence types include Learner's Licence, Permanent Licence, and Commercial Licence.

Renewal is required within 30 days after expiry to avoid a late penalty of ₹1000 per year.

Driving without a valid licence may result in a ₹5000 fine.

You can access a digital copy through DigiLocker if your physical driving licence is lost.
